Certa Stampa – SUCCESS FOR THE ITALIAN MASTERS FOR TERAMO NUOTO

Success for Teramo Nuoto at the Italian Master Swimming Championships of the Italian Swimming Federation. Over three thousand athletes present from 25 to 30 June at the Riccione Swimming Stadium to honor this last seasonal appointment in the long pool.

A new national title for Alessandro Fioralba who becomes Italian M40 Champion in the 50 breaststroke with a time of 30″.49. A truly excellent performance, embellished by the extraordinary two silvers in the 100 and 200 breaststroke, just a few hundredths of a second away from a fantastic hat-trick.

Fioralba thus reaches 8 medals in the Italian FIN and UISP Championships only in this fantastic 23/24 season (5 golds and 3 silvers).

“I am very happy for Ale and for the whole team” says coach and manager Luca Primoli, “in addition to the three medals, Teramo Nuoto has placed 4 athletes in the top 10, namely Marco Campitelli, Gianna Paolitto, Felipe Caporusso and Elvira Scotucci.
